Michael Gove’s surprise decision to lower the proposed height threshold for second staircases in new residential blocks will stall more schemes and could lead to redundancies, industry experts have warned.
The housing secretary stunned the built environment sector yesterday by revealing the government is now intending to lower the requirement for additional stair cores in buildings from the 30m proposed last year to 18m.
